Gwendolyn "Gwen" Zinzow Obituary

Elkhorn – Gwendolyn (Gwen) R. Zinzow, died at Ridgestone Gardens, Elkhorn, WI, June 9, 2021. Gwen was born July 31, 1923  to Robert and Mona (Oakes) Archambault in Milton, WI. She was united in marriage Oct. 10, 1942 in Delavan, WI to Marvin F Zinzow. Marvin preceded her in death July 20, 2009.

She was a supervisor at Borg Manufacturing in Delavan during the early years of World War II. Following the war, Gwen and Marvin made their home in Elkhorn. Gwen was active in the Lakeland Hospital Pink Ladies, Elkhorn Women's Club, and with her husband in VFW. During the 1960s and 1970s she taught ceramics and enjoyed creating her own artistic pieces. She was a seamstress making dolls with Raggedy Ann and Andy her specialty and loved needlepoint. Upon moving to Lake Havasu City, Arizona, in 1979, she continued to volunteer her time at the local hospital, teaching ceramics and helping Marvin shoot grades for the new houses he was building. Ten years later, they moved back to Elkhorn. She was famous for her cinnamon rolls, pies and cookies, usually creating a flour dust storm in the process. During her nearly 12 years at Ridgestone assisted living, she was often the unofficial greeter to new arrivals, making them just a bit happier with her infectious smile and twinkling eyes. Gwen especially liked playing Yatzee and going on day trips with her daughter, Nancy.
